One of the most common questions we get is "When should I visit La Fortuna?" The honest answer: any time of year is great, but each season offers different advantages. This guide breaks down the weather, wildlife activity, crowd levels, and pricing by month so you can choose the perfect time for your trip.
Dry Season (December–April)
The dry season offers sunny mornings, easier trail conditions, and the best chance to see Arenal Volcano without cloud cover. This is peak tourist season, so book tours 2–3 weeks in advance. Wildlife is concentrated near water sources, making sightings easier. Temperatures average 28–33°C (82–91°F).
Green Season (May–November)
The "rainy" season is actually the best time for nature lovers. Rain usually falls in the afternoon, leaving mornings clear for tours. The rainforest is at its lushest, waterfalls are at their most powerful, and birdwatching diversity peaks with migratory species arriving in October. Prices are 15–25% lower and crowds are minimal.
Best Months for Wildlife
February–April: nesting season for many bird species. May–June: frog and amphibian activity peaks. October–March: migratory birds arrive (warblers, tanagers, raptors). Year-round: sloths, toucans, monkeys, and nocturnal wildlife are active regardless of season.
Month-by-Month Summary
Jan–Mar: Dry, sunny, peak season, higher prices. Apr: Transitional, fewer crowds, great deals. May–Jun: Green season begins, lush landscapes, excellent frogs. Jul–Aug: Mini dry season ("veranillo"), good balance. Sep–Oct: Wettest months, best bird migration, lowest prices. Nov: Rain easing, still green, great value. Dec: Dry season starts, holiday crowds return.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the actual best month to visit La Fortuna?
For clear Arenal Volcano views and easy trails, February and March are the best months. For wildlife, photography and value, choose May, June or November — rain usually falls in the afternoon, so morning tours run normally.
Is the rainy season a bad time for tours in Arenal?
No. In the green season (May–November) mornings are usually clear and the rain arrives after 1–2 PM. We simply schedule wildlife walks, hanging bridges and waterfall visits early, and keep hot springs for the afternoon.
When is the best time for birdwatching in La Fortuna?
October through March, when North American migrants join the resident species. Nesting activity for resident birds peaks between February and April. Early morning departures (5:30–6:00 AM) are essential year-round.

Will I see the Arenal Volcano summit?
The summit is clearest in the early morning, especially January–April. Even in wet months, the volcano usually clears for a while at sunrise, which is why our Arenal 1968 and hanging bridges tours start early.
